X-Git-Url: https://git.arvados.org/arvados.git/blobdiff_plain/84eaf88d6836d730ef89d1433233a5f21d36ebb4..31e1d10eb4a54b13f55b3c9638f46032be633ff9:/apps/workbench/app/assets/javascripts/sizing.js diff --git a/apps/workbench/app/assets/javascripts/sizing.js b/apps/workbench/app/assets/javascripts/sizing.js index 3d60274439..2341628fa7 100644 --- a/apps/workbench/app/assets/javascripts/sizing.js +++ b/apps/workbench/app/assets/javascripts/sizing.js @@ -20,10 +20,12 @@ function smart_scroll_fixup(s) { } s.each(function(i, a) { - var h = window.innerHeight - $(a).offset().top; + a = $(a); + var h = window.innerHeight - a.offset().top - a.attr("data-smart-scroll-padding-bottom"); height = String(h) + "px"; - $(a).css('max-height', height); + a.css('max-height', height); }); } $(window).on('load ready resize scroll ajax:complete', smart_scroll_fixup); +$(document).on('shown.bs.tab', 'ul.nav-tabs > li > a', smart_scroll_fixup);